#3 His Deep Ties to Big Pharma

When it comes to Joe Manchin and Big Pharma, the two are thick as thieves. His daughter is CEO of Mylan, which has peddled harmful opioid drugs like Fentanyl and raised the prices of life-saving EpiPens by 500%.

Not to be left out, Manchin’s wife spearheaded an effort to require schools across the country to purchase EpiPens.

All the while, Joe Manchin has raked in campaign cash from Mylan, his second largest campaign contributor.

Oh, and don’t forget that his campaign’s senior adviser, Larry Puccio, is a lobbyist for Mylan and Manchin’s hotel investing partner.

#4 His Shady Hotel Dealings

For months, Manchin’s reelection effort has been mired in scandal as he’s tried to hide his wealth and dubious investments.

It all began when Manchin and his investment partner/Mylan lobbyist/campaign adviser were named in a bankruptcy lawsuit for Mountain Blue Hotel Group.

The company has been sued for defaulting on loans and has been raided to collect unpaid taxes. Manchin has tap-danced around the scandal by continuously changing stories, and at times, outright lying. 

Now Manchin is the subject of a Senate Ethics investigation for his failure to disclose his investment in the hotels. Good luck explaining that to voters!
